PUTNAM COUNTY, Fla. — One of two 18-year-old men found inside a condemned home in Putnam County with two young teenage girls has now bonded out of jail.
Justin Quintana and Erasmo Mercado were arrested Friday morning when deputies went to that Georgetown home.
Inside, deputies say they found drugs and drug-related items. The two are now facing several charges including felony drug possession.
“I'd say I'm not surprised reason is this has been going on for quite some time,” said Michael Rock, a neighbor.
Mercado and Quintana were not alone according to the police report. A 14-year-old girl and a 15-year-old girl were also inside.

One of the girls told sheriff's deputies she was about to have sex with Mercado when sheriff's deputies showed up.
“Pretty shocked about it -- it's just… indescribable the things that are going on,” Sheriff’s Office said.
According to the police report the girl's mother says Mercado is a member of the gang the Latin Kings.
Mercado and Quintana were arrested without incident, but people in the community hope law enforcement can step up their patrolling.
Mercado and Quintana are booked in the Putnam County jail on bond over $2,000.
The two girls were released to the custody of their parents.
